Easy to Manoeuvre
Three-wheeled pushchairs are more comfortable to navigate than four-wheeled ones and some even provide better stability on uneven terrain. Choose a model that has a lockable front wheel to make it more comfortable to control, particularly in the event that you plan to use it off-road or on uneven surfaces. Some three-wheeled models are designed specifically for jogging. For instance, the phil&teds Terrain premium jogger, which melds precision steering and maximum control for getting active, with refined styling and world class maneuverability.
When you are looking for a three-wheeled stroller, consider how easy it is to fold and if it fits into the boot of your vehicle. Consider how versatile it can be - can it accommodate with a second seat or carry cot, for example? You can purchase adapters that make this possible.
